Excited to grow your career?BBVA is a global company with more than 160 years of history that operates in more than 25 countries where we serve more than 80 million customers. We are more than 121,000 professionals working in multidisciplinary teams with profiles as diverse as financiers, legal experts, data scientists, developers, engineers and designers.About the job:As the Project Manager of Solutions Development for Uk and CE, you will be responsible for conceptualizing, designing, coordinating, planification, testing, and implementing projects for specialized Financial Markets. Join the Engineering CIB UK and Continental Europe team, present in 4 countries, supporting the diverse growth plans in the region (both CIB and BEC).The ideal candidate should possess:

About the Position:Description:
- Managing engineering projects in the UK/CE area.
- Assisting in the Prioritization, Definition, Follow up, Reporting, Execution and implementation of strategic plans for BBVA UK&CE
- Gathering and interpreting Business requirements, defining high-level functional and technical designs in the Investment Banking domain with advanced knowledge of products and processes.
- Governance of the project production cycle in a financial markets software development and implementation process.
- Primary contact with internal clients.
- Coordination of IT projects with other involved areas in BBVA.
- Monitoring of technological costs and cooperation with the Finance department in the IT budget preparation

Requirements:
- Good knowledge of financial products in general, and business lines of business for Global Markets, GTB and/or IB&F
- Experience in defining, developing, and implementing IT projects, KPI’s and reporting of the same
- General knowledge, although not detailed, of other financial market platforms such as Murex, Calypso, etc.
- Experience working within SCRUM teams and in AGILE project execution models.
- High-level competencies in Initiative, Involvement, Innovation, Results Orientation, Customer Service, and Teamwork.
- Fluent and agile communication skills in English, both spoken and written (ideally C1at least).
